Abstract :
Recently, there has been increased interest in evolutionary computation applied to changing optimization problems. The paper surveys a number of approaches that extend the evolutionary algorithm with implicit or explicit memory, suggests a new benchmark problem and examines under which circumstances a memory may be helpful. From these observations, we derive a new way to explore the benefits of a memory while minimizing its negative side effects
